felix-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Stuart McCulloch (JIRA)" <j...@apache.org>
Subject [jira] Created: (FELIX-218) Support BND directives in maven-bundle-plugin section of pom.xml
Date Tue, 27 Feb 2007 08:31:05 GMT
Support BND directives in maven-bundle-plugin section of pom.xml

                 Key: FELIX-218
                 URL: https://issues.apache.org/jira/browse/FELIX-218
             Project: Felix
          Issue Type: Improvement
          Components: Maven Plugin
    Affects Versions: 1.0.0
            Reporter: Stuart McCulloch
            Priority: Minor
             Fix For: 1.0.0

The latest snapshot of the maven-bundle-plugin doesn't support BND directives (such as -donotcopy)
in the pom.xml

Unfortunately we can't have XML tags that start with '-', so we have to use '_' in the XML
and convert this to '-' in the plugin.

For example:

            <bundleName>My Bundle</bundleName>
            ... etc ...

I have a simple patch for this issue, which also adds support for the '-include' directive
to let you drag in other property files.
This can be useful if you have a common set of manifest entries defined in a parent project
- however, this requires a patch
to BND to expose an API to process the include directive, as currently it's only processed
when properties are loaded from
a file - not when they are set programatically.

This message is automatically generated by JIRA.
You can reply to this email to add a comment to the issue online.

View raw message